Essential Diesel Truck Issues That Demand Quick Response
Despite regular maintenance schedules, diesel trucks might encounter problems needing prompt specialized service. A critical issue involves the fuel system—where filter contamination, injector problems, or contaminated fuel often lead to reduced engine output, rough idle, or full system stoppage. Immediate troubleshooting is crucial to stop additional engine damage and costly downtime. Another significant issue needing quick attention is engine overheating. Low coolant, faulty thermostats, or broken water pumps may lead to rapid temperature increases. Ignoring overheating issues may result in component distortion or catastrophic engine failure. Taking immediate action ensures your truck performing optimally and prevents costly repairs. Stay alert for warning signs to guarantee your diesel truck's reliability.

Mobile vs. Workshop Diesel Repair Solutions
When your diesel vehicle or fleet experiences unplanned mechanical issues, choosing between on-site and in-shop repair services becomes an important consideration impacting downtime and operational efficiency. On-site diesel repair brings the technician directly to your location, reducing towing needs and reducing time off the road. This service is ideal for small fixes, rapid mechanical assessment, and immediate troubleshooting—supporting optimal fuel efficiency. However, complicated problems like major system repairs or advanced diagnostics may need specific tools only available in-shop.
Shop-based diesel repair delivers a controlled environment with specialized equipment, extensive parts availability, and professional lifts. Should your equipment demand detailed examination or complex maintenance, moving it to a repair center provides accuracy and attention to detail. Evaluate the repair's urgency and business requirements when making your decision.

Essential Preventive Maintenance Tips to Minimize Emergency Breakdowns
Setting up a structured preventive maintenance routine significantly decreases the likelihood of unexpected diesel engine malfunctions. Start by scheduling regular checks of your engine's fluid and filtration components, as these elements play a significant role in proper fuel efficiency. Monitor fuel lines for damage or deterioration to avoid sudden performance issues. Proper tire care is equally important; monitor tire pressure and tread depth regularly to maintain safe handling and avoid blowouts. Rotate and balance your tires according to manufacturer guidelines to prolong their lifespan and ensure even wear. Pay attention to battery terminals—maintain and secure connections to avoid electrical malfunctions. Resolve minor issues promptly, as unattended concerns can transform into costly emergency breakdowns. Regular, meticulous care maintains your vehicle operating dependably on the road.
